Guest there are a lot of jobs with concentrations of immigrants in them. Nation,look across the we do not see any jobs where unauthorized immigrants are a majority, but there are a lot of unauthorized immigrants seem to be somewhere between a quarter and half the workers. They tend right to be jobs that are physically demanding and lowpaying, but even having said that, there are u. S. Born people in virtually all of these jobs. Host lets hear from steven.
